Local market witnesses heavy trading during the week

u003cpu003eu003cstrongu003eThe local stock market was characterized by heavy trading during the week. A total of 31.5 million shares were exchanged for a total value of Rs 404.4 million, which saw the indices lose ground during the week.u003c/strongu003eu003c/pu003eu003cpu003eThe SEMDEX and the SEMTRI dropped -0.7% and 0.66% respectively at the end of the days under review (11-18 April 2016). The All-share index, SEMDEX, closed the session of Monday 18 April 2016 at 1,778.05 points against 1,790.54 points a week earlier. The Total Return Index, SEMTRI, closed the same session at 6,029.98 points. The SEM-10 index, which comprises the ten largest and most liquid stocks, closed at 340.99 points. The market capitalisation stood Rs 201.11 billion at market close on Monday.u003c/pu003eu003cpu003eThe top five traded securities were: Bayport Management Ltd (BML), Promotion and Development Ltd (PAD), MCB Group Limited (MCBG), Lux Island Resorts Ltd (LUX) and SBM Holdings Ltd (SBMH). They were exchanged for a total value of Rs 235.4 million, Rs 32.4 million, Rs 30.6 million, Rs 19.6 million and Rs 16.7 million respectively. The shares of BML, PAD, MCBG, LUX and SBMH closed at USD 4.40, Rs 89.50, Rs 207.75, Rs 58.50 and Re 0.65.u003c/pu003eu003cpu003eAn analysis of the evolution of the prices of listed stocks indicates that out of the 59 stocks figuring on the Official List, 10 moved up during the week, 30 remained stable and 19 went down. The best performing stocks for the week were: Atlantic Leaf Properties Limited (+3.57%), National Investment Trust Ltd (+2.24%), Alteo Ltd (+1.85%), Omnicane Ltd (+1.52%) and United Basalt Products Ltd (+1.27%). The worst performers were: Automatic Systems Ltd (-24.48%), Air Mauritius Ltd (-7.80%), BlueLife Limited (-6.25%), Rogers u0026amp; Co.
